Google has published a new way of pre-training a language model which is augmented using a knowledge retrieval mechanism, that looks up existing knowledge from an external Wikipedia corpus. This makes the outputs the trained language model generates more fact-based and vast. It uses masked language modeling transformers for training and learns to retrieve and attend from millions of Wiki documents.

Retrieval-Augmented Language Representation Model Pre-training

检索增强语言表示模型预训练

Humans also have limited capacity to store information, and most of the knowledge is stored externally and we just use the right tools (Google!) to access that information by simply doing a google search for instance. So why not teach the language model to do the same thing! That’s where Google has created a new knowledge retrieval mechanism that works along side the transformer model. The model when trying to generate an output doesn’t just take the help of it’s internal weights (like most transformers until now), but goes to an external document repository (Wikipedia Corpus) to support its predictions which makes the outputs much more accurate and reliable than just looking at it’s own encoded weights.

人类存储信息的能力也很有限,并且大多数知识都存储在外部,我们仅使用正确的工具(例如Google!)就可以通过简单的Google搜索来访问该信息。 那么,为什么不教语言模型做同样的事情呢! 在那里,Google创建了一种新的知识检索机制,该机制可与转换器模型一起使用。 尝试生成输出时,该模型不仅利用其内部权重(像到目前为止的大多数转换器一样),还使用外部文档存储库(Wikipedia Corpus)来支持其预测,从而使输出更加准确,比仅查看其自身的编码权重更可靠。

So during the pre-training step, this model is not encoding the knowledge inside it, but it’s learning to search for the right document from the external repository. This process of externalizing the knowledge retrieval has many advantages:

  • It doesn’t need billions of parameters to store this world knowledge. They have demonstrated that there model with only 300 million parameters performs as well as 11 billion parameters used in the earlier T5 language model.

  • The external knowledge repository works asynchronously and is independent of the language model. Right now they are using Wikipedia, but in the future they could use the power of their search engine. So REALM can google search just like us to provide an answer to a question. Also this solves the problem of keeping the model up-to-date without needing to retrain the big model again and again saving money and time.

  • It’s much easier to debug where it’s getting it’s answers from, as the model can now provide with an index of the document it referred, to support the arguments it’s making. This would be great for applications which need fact-checking and more reliable knowledge access.

Model Architecture

模型架构

  • Neural Knowledge Retriever (KR): This model is also a neural network, which is trained along with the transformer in an end-to-end differential fashion just like any other deep learning model. The job of this model is to attend millions of documents (Wikipedia) and choose the best document that would support the given input sentence, and this “real” fact sentence retrieved from the knowledge base is appended to the input sentence.

  • Transformer: This is the same transformer model used previously with many layers of self-attention block which attends over every word in the input and outputs the predicted sequence. But the context of input is larger because it has to not only attend to the input sentence but also to the sentence extracted from the wiki document.

Training Process: This is the simplest way to explain how they augment the language model. You will need a little knowledge about how to train transformers to understand this.

  • The first step is getting a tokenized sentence from a raw dataset (any internet corpus). Then you randomly mask a word (or span of words) and give this tokenized sentence (in embedded vector form) along with positional embedding to the REALM model.

  • The job of REALM model is to predict what words the masked tokens should be, and it does that by assigning probability to all the words in a vocabulary set, and the highest probability is the word it chooses. In more simpler words, the model is trained to fill-in-the-blanks.

  • Based on the output and how close it is to the real tokens (before masking) a loss is calculated. This loss is back-propogated through the model and is used to train the weights/parameters and the goal of training is to minimize this loss.

  • In the classical transformer model, we only have one transformer, which has many layers of language and knowledge representation hidden in the parameters. The layers work together using a self-attention layer (which attends all the words in the sentence) to predict what the model thinks should be the predicted word. In fact, if you look at the top 10 words having the highest probability, they would all make certain sense based on the input sentence, but the highest probability is always the best word chosen given the input sentence. But because of the limited parameters and the vast and unlimited knowledge available to attend and ponder, classic transformers would fail to give the exact word you would want, especially for specific world facts.

  • In REALM, first the input embedded tokens are given to the KR. The job of KR is to search the document (from millions of documents) which closely matched the given input tokens. This documents are first pre-computed using neural network weights and assigned a vector which gives a location and direction in multi-dimensional (128-dim) space. So it’s a like a big search index just like the Google algorithm would use now when you search for a term in their website.

  • Then using a method called Maximum Inner Product Search (MIPS). MIPS calculates inner products between the query vector and each target document vector. The vector which returns the maximum output, has the selected document which has the best supporting sentence for the input sentence.

  • The document vectors are pre-computed (this means most related documents are clustered together) so the query vector finds a neighborhood in the vector space, which best matches what it’s looking for. Think of it like you are grocery shopping, and look for almond milk, you will go to the milk section because they arranged all the products they are selling in clusters. But if the products was kept randomly anywhere in the store, you will have a hard time finding anything you want.

  • So during training the KR has to recompute this arrangement of the target vectors so that the next query vector has an easier time finding what it wants. It does it by getting the loss value from the transformer output and updating the gradients.

  • Once we have the document sentence retrieved, we append the document text along with input sentence and provide it to the transformer. The layers in transformer perform rich cross-attention between the text and the supporting document text, and if the attention weights are learned correctly, it will learn to map the document text with the input text, and predict the missing word more accurately. But if the retrieved document text doesn’t help it predict the word correctly, then that loss signal is passed through the retriever so that it learns to do it’s job better.

  • And if you have the right configuration and size and train this for a while, you will have a model which not only learns to retrieve the correct document but also predict output sequences correctly. And you get the document index from the corpus for your debugging purposes as a bonus.

The main advantage here is the transformer doesn’t have to hard code a lot of general facts, that task is off-loaded. This results in as you will see later a much lighter Transformer model with less parameters, but still performs well on knowledge-intensive tasks such as question-answering.

Knowledge Retriever Training

This section goes into a little more detail about what’s happening inside KR. Each document is encoded using a Dense Passage Retrieval technique which gives a bi-directional encoding for the text in each document. You can think of this as some form of compressed encoding which gives some important features for each document in a form which you can match in a hyper-dimensional space with an input query vector. Then the MIPS technique mentioned above does a nearest-neighbor search using the neural network weights to match with the target documents.

Major challenge is there are millions of documents to search through which provides two problems: first encoding millions of document and keeping them in memory would require a large memory and then training the neural weights for all of this weights would take ages even with the fastest computation available. Google solves this by

  • training and matching the input vector with only a small amount of encoded documents at a time.

  • Recomputing the document encoding (search index builder) asynchronously, so the transformer will continue training with a snapshot of the knowledge base, while the KB is updating itself in the background. Since, recomputing millions of documents takes time.

So two jobs run parallely in the KR, a primary trainer job which updates the embed parameters every step by listening to the training signal from the transformer. And the index builder which indexes the document based on the embed parameters. The trainer for each step uses a snapshot of the index, and the index takes it’s own time to re-index based on the latest model parameters, and then when it’s done re-indexing updates the snapshot.

They have shown that training of transformer doesn’t affect the performance even if the index building occurs 500 steps later. Which means for 500 steps the trainer and the transformer are using a “stale” knowledge base, but it still is enough for the transformer to give accurate predictions.

One more advantage of re-indexing asynchronously is that the knowledge corpus can be kept up-to-date with the latest events and document vectors recalculated when the model is eventually put into production without changing the model or retraining it.
